Output 88094d57b3376d499a3d7f6105137f7e1d06b97aebef4a7654128358cef613d5:18

value
386882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d7bd0561184c1720fac74e53633a3c27f5b202 OP_EQUAL
address
35sQmwVk3FwBaHGu8GtBb2oaZQ6gyK4cDv
transaction
88094d57b3376d499a3d7f6105137f7e1d06b97aebef4a7654128358cef613d5
spent
true